WebThe GoodRx final order, if approved by the FTC, would require the company to pay $1.5 million in civil penalties and permanently cease sharing health information with third parties for any advertising purpose, thus demonstrating the FTC’s desire to impose new, aggressive remedies against digital health apps and connected devices. WebFeb 9, 2024 · The proposed order resolving the enforcement action imposes a $1.5 million civil penalty and a first-of-its-kind ban on sharing health information with third parties for targeted advertising purposes. The FTC voted 4-0 in support of the action, with a concurring statement issued by Commissioner Christine S. Wilson. GoodRx’s alleged practices

WebFeb 1, 2024 · To settle this matter, GoodRx will pay a $1.5 million penalty. The company is prohibited from sharing health data with relevant third parties (like Facebook) that would use it for advertising, and must get users’ permission to share health data with relevant third parties for anything else.
